About Ric Rice

Ric Rice

I am exploring the placement of the values of color with harmonious balance, creating a combination of complementary juxtaposition. Using active brush strokes creates a textured surface where color and form give way to unsuspected depth. These methods allow the imagination to wander into a poetic yet lyrical abstract world. Abstract painting originates from interpreting optical frequencies of color and motion while deciphering its placement. Exploring visually arresting compositions that accentuate textures, And what's between these colors are the new horizons of exploration.
